Don't use destroyed wxToolBar in wxFrame::SetToolBar() in wxQt

Store QToolBar pointer in wxFrame itself to avoid having to query the
already half-destroyed wxToolBar object when SetToolBar() is called from
its base class dtor.

This fixes crash when toggling the toolbar in the toolbar sample.

Closes https://github.com/wxWidgets/wxWidgets/pull/1140
